Job Summary:
The Physiotherapist or Physical Therapist is an individual who holds a current, valid license issued under a national authority or board that authorizes them to practice Physical Therapy and use the title Physical Therapist.
Physiotherapist or Physical therapists are health care professionals who help individuals maintain, restore, and improve movement, activity, and functioning, thereby enabling optimal performance and enhancing health, well-being, and quality of life.
Job Responsibilities:
- Perform screening and evaluation of patients carried out in a systematic way prior to initiating physiotherapy treatment using a facility standardized format.
- Develop and implement a physiotherapy treatment plan of care based on the prescription of referring physician, screening, and evaluation of each patient’s presentation and condition in order to achieved results
- Re-evaluation including re-examination of the patient and a review of plan of care with appropriate continuation, revision, or termination of treatment based on the progress of patient’s condition.
- Documentation and recording of physiotherapy services including the initial examination and evaluation, the plan of care, Follow up treatment session, re-evaluations, patient conferences/meetings and discharge status.
- Operates and maintains sophisticated instruments and equipment used in Physiotherapy and is able to properly set up, calibrate, maintain, operate and shut down such instruments as per user manuals, policies and procedures
- Actively participates in Quality Improvement Programs essential to ensure that physiotherapy modalities are accurate, effective, efficient and meets customer needs.
- Educate, guide and provide training to new physiotherapist, technicians and trainees in performing modalities and to ensure that new staff learn the department’s standard operating procedures, protocols and policies
- Maintains competence in Health Information System and software applications that is crucial to the operations to ensure accurate patient electronic medical records.
- Perform inventory of supplies, such as, consumables, chemicals, and reagents to ensure appropriate stocks, for daily operation in performing test on day-to-day basis.
- Monitor, record, and maintain machines, equipment and instruments optimal working condition and calibration. Report any issues, breakdown and/or malfunction immediately to HOD or appropriate responsible department to ensure safe operation and provision of accurate results as per policies and procedure.
- Maintain confidentiality regarding patient health information to ensure privacy and respect.
